
Cymbidium Paradisian Tiger 'Green Falls'
Cymbidium Paradisian Tiger 'Green Falls' is a selected cultivar from the grex Cymbidium Paradisian Tiger. This hybrid, registered by Paradisia Nurseries in 2015, is a cross between Cymbidium Tiny Tiger and Cymbidium Sarah Jean. It features green flowers with a striking dark spotted lip, blooming in late winter. The plant produces multiple spikes per bulb and is best grown in containers using a free-draining orchid mix.
Key Characteristics
- Flower size: Medium (approx. 6 cm)
- Flower colour & pattern: Green petals and sepals with heavily spotted maroon lip
- Spike habit: Multiple spikes per bulb
- Blooming season: Late season (August)
- Plant size: Medium
- Growth habit: Clumping
- Fragrance: Not fragrant (not noted)
- Flower count per spike: Moderate to high (estimated from image)
- Bloom longevity: 4–6 weeks
Care Notes
- Position: Bright filtered light or morning sun
- Water: Water freely in active growth; reduce in winter
- Potting: Use free-draining orchid mix; pot culture only
- Feeding: Fortnightly during growth; switch to bloom formula late summer
- Climate: Cool to temperate conditions
- Repotting: Every 2–3 years after flowering
